When a number is multiplied by itself thrice, the resultant number is called the cube of a number. Cubing is used when comparing sizes of objects or things with cubic measurements. In this topic, we shall learn about the cube of 383.
A cube number is a value obtained by raising a number to the power of 3, or by multiplying the number by itself three times.
When you cube a positive number, the result is always positive.
When you cube a negative number, the result is always negative.
This is because a negative number multiplied by itself three times results in a negative number.
The cube of 383 can be written as 383³, which is the exponential form.
Or it can also be written in arithmetic form as, 383 × 383 × 383.

The formula (a + b)³ is a binomial formula for finding the cube of a number. The formula is expanded as a³ + 3a²b + 3ab² + b³.
Step 1: Split the number 383 into two parts, as 380 and 3. Let a = 380 and b = 3, so a + b = 383
Step 2: Now, apply the formula (a + b)³ = a³ + 3a²b + 3ab² + b³
Step 3: Calculate each term a³ = 380³ 3a²b = 3 × 380² × 3 3ab² = 3 × 380 × 3² b³ = 3³
Step 4: Add all the terms together: (a + b)³ = a³ + 3a²b + 3ab² + b³ (380 + 3)³ = 380³ + 3 × 380² × 3 + 3 × 380 × 3² + 3³ 383³ = 54,872,000 + 1,296,600 + 10,260 + 27 383³ = 56,213,087
Step 5: Hence, the cube of 383 is 56,213,087.

If the side length of the cube is 383 cm, what is the volume?
The volume is 56,213,087 cm³.
Use the volume formula for a cube V = Side³.
Substitute 383 for the side length: V = 383³ = 56,213,087 cm³.
How much larger is 383³ than 380³?
383³ – 380³ = 1,341,087.
First, find the cube of 383, that is 56,213,087.
Next, find the cube of 380, which is 54,872,000.
Now, find the difference between them using the subtraction method. 56,213,087 – 54,872,000 = 1,341,087.
Therefore, 383³ is 1,341,087 larger than 380³.
